Which Fixed Wireless and LTE Internet Providers are Available in Gray Mountain?
Choice Fixed Wireless in Gray Mountain, AZ
Choice Wireless offers Fixed Wireless service to 56.0% of Gray Mountain homes. Across the city, Choice Fixed Wireless is the only type of service available from the company, with speeds up to 193 Mbps, with speeds from 25 Mpbs up to 200 Mbps depending on the address. Upload speeds differ from download speeds, and are as low 5.0 and as high as 20, with an average of 19 Mbps throughout the city.
Ethos Broadband Fixed Wireless in Gray Mountain, AZ
Ethos Broadband offers Fixed Wireless service to 8.9% of Gray Mountain homes. Across the city, Ethos Broadband Fixed Wireless is the only type of service available from the company, with speeds up to 173 Mbps, with speeds from 100 Mpbs up to 200 Mbps depending on the address. Upload speeds differ from download speeds, and are as low 25 and as high as 40, with an average of 36 Mbps throughout the city.
